On 26 August 2015 at 00:30, Jon Leech <[email protected]> wrote: > When I invoked a2x as e.g. > > a2x -v -d manpage -f manpage --asciidoc-opts "-f config/manpages.conf" > --no-xmllint --xsltproc-opts= man/sharingMode.txt > --destination-dir=../../../out/man/3 > > it complains: > > a2x: WARNING: --destination-dir option is only applicable to HTML based > outputs > > But it does generate ../../../out/man/3/sharingMode.3 . Am I missing > something here? Why is it > complaining about non-HTML output but still using the destination dir > (which, don't get me wrong, > is the desired behavior - I just don't see *why* it feels a need to > complain). Is there any way to > suppress the complaint?
